Shuttle crew. Portrait of the crew of the space shuttle Discovery during mission STS-095 (29th October - 7th November 1998). At centre left is Chiaki Naito-Muka, payload specialist representing Japan's space agency (NASDA). Clockwise from Naito-Muka are: Scott F. Parazynski, mission specialist; John H. Glenn payload specialist; Curtis L. Brown, mission commander; Steven W. Lindsey, pilot; Stephen K. Robinson, mission specialist; and Pedro Duque, mission specialist representing the European Space Agency (ESA). The purposes of this mission were to conduct experiments and launch and retrieve the Spartan satellite. | |
